Sunderland – £43 million for 31 goals


Let’s just say this season for Sunderland is not what everyone was expecting it to be, let’s go back 7 months, the fans are all hyped up as the Black Cats have just brought in an England international and a Scottish international which cost 24 million between them, everyone was expecting Europa league but instead we are fighting to stay in the premier league. Sunderland over the past 2 years have spent 43 million on an attack who have scored 31 goals between them, let’s take an in depth look at each attacker and what they have brought to the club.
 




Danny Graham – £5 million
Maybe Danny Graham has been placed on this list unfairly as he has only made 6 appearances for the club, but the reason I placed him on this list is because so far he has done what everyone including myself thought he would do which is absolutely nothing, I am not saying he is a waste of money because he has not exactly had the warmest of welcomes off the fans due to his Geordie root’s, but he has not exactly proved the fans wrong by being a spectator for the games that he has played.

Steven Fletcher – £12 million

Again, maybe Steven Fletcher has been unfairly placed on this list as he is on the small list of players that have actually done something for the club this season scoring 11 goals, but with a £12 million price tag you would think he would manage more goals than 11, but saying that at the start of the season he did predict that he would score 12 goals which he is well on route to doing, but £1 million per goal does not sit right with me and I have to say I was expecting more from the Scottish International this season, plus have you noticed Fletchers history with teams, Burnley got relegated, Wolves got relegated and now Sunderland are on the verge of being relegated, maybe he is a bad luck charm?

Connor Wickham - £8 million

At 19 years old Connor Wickham still has a bright future, he has all the great attributes to become a great forward someday he is well built, tall and he has a bit of pace about him, but if you ask me I think he needs a bit more experience in a lower league before he even thinks about making it in the Premier League, and the loan to Sheffield Wednesday is sure to help him get the experience he needs, and maybe next season we will see the name Wickham on the score sheet a lot more, but again he is another player who has not yet rose to the level his price tag would suggest.

Stéphane Sessègnon – £6 million

You may be a little shocked to see the little Beninese international on this list as he is again on the small list of players that have actually done something for the club this season, but especially last season not only was he the clubs top scorer with 8 goals but he won the clubs player of the season, the reason I have placed him on this list is because after last season we were expecting the same Sessègnon but sadly we have just not got what we were expecting from him, not that he has let us down on anything he has probably been our best player in the last 5 games or so if you do not count Mignolet, but after the great season he had last year he has just not delivered.

Adam Johnson - £12 million

And now we get to the player that I like to call the ‘Hyped up let down’ when it was announced in August last year that Johnson had signed for us I could not stop smiling I thought for sure he was going to be the player that was going to turn the club around, but silly me he has done nothing apart from score the goal that saw us beat Man City at home for the second season running in December last year. What I saw Johnson do at Man City and what he has done at Sunderland it looks like I have watched two totally different players, yes he did not start a lot of games at City but when he came on as a sub it looked like he totally changed the game around, he is just not the same player at Sunderland, yes the players are not of the same class as they are at City but you think if Johnson was everything we made him out to be he would adapt and that’s why it pains me to say he is one of the club’s biggest waste of money in recent history
